Abstract

A tunable RF filter, comprising: an emitter follower stage (); and a common emitter stage (); the common emitter stage () providing feedback to the emitter follower stage (). The common emitter stage () may comprise a first transistor (Ti) being the only transistor of the common emitter stage (); and the emitter follower stage () may comprise a second transistor (T) being the only transistor of the emitter follower stage (). A further tunable RF filter provides improved linearity, comprising: an emitter follower stage (); a joint common emitter and emitter follower stage (); and a gain stage (); a common emitter output of the joint common emitter and emitter follower stage () providing feedback to the emitter follower stage (), and an emitter follower output of the joint common emitter and emitter follower stage () providing an input to the gain stage ().
